Nineteen hundred and fifty-eight witnessed many noteworthy events: the United States launched its first successful satellite; the plastic hula hoop was put on the market; The Bridge over the River Kwai won 7 Academy Awards; NASA was formerly created; President Dwight Eisenhower and Richard Nixon were in the White House; and Vladimir Nabokov's Lolita was published here in the good ole USA. Tensions were high in every american home as the country was smack dab in the middle of the cold war and the Space Race.
It was in this environment that comic book veteran Jack Kirby, scripters Dick and Dave Wood, and inker Wallace Wood created a space themed comic strip theatrically entitled Sky Masters of the Space Force. This handsome, beautifully crafted strip only ran for a little under two-and-a-half years and even though it's over sixty years old the feature manages to be entertaining and nostalgic.
This reprint of Sky Masters collects the complete daily continuity and boasts the best reproduction of the strip ever
